Original abstract

Driven by advances in diffusion models and autoregressive models, the fidelity and resolution of AI-generated images now rival those of real images. However, existing AI-generated image detection methods often downsample the images, inevitably overlooking critical low-level texture details in high-resolution AI-generated images, therefore limiting their detection performance. In addition, the ceaseless emergence of unknown generative models makes large-scale pre-training datasets inaccessible. To address these challenges, we propose a novel high-resolution AI-generated image detector, termed LHSDet. Specifically, we formulate the AI-generated image detection task as a Visual Question Answering problem, leveraging a fine-tuned vision-language framework to fully exploit the complementary information between visual and textual modalities. Recognizing that the default visual encoder of existing vision-language models is not tailored for AI-generated image detection, we redesign a visual encoder to better capture both the low-level and high-level artifacts inherent in AI-generated images. Furthermore, we incorporate a semantic-level textual branch to enable multi-modal feature fusion and detection. Consequently, LHSDet employs a triple-branch architecture to extract complementary multi-modal features: a low-level visual branch that aggregates non-overlapping patches for local texture cues, a high-level visual branch based on SigLIP2 for global perception feature extraction, and a semantic-level textual branch that generates captions using BLIP-2. Extensive experimental results demonstrate that LHSDet achieves high detection accuracy and robust performance across diverse generative models, including both diffusion and autoregressive models.
